5 Easy Steps to Implement a CX Platform

In today's digital landscape, customers expect personalized and efficient interactions with brands. Companies that fail to deliver a seamless customer experience risk losing customers to competitors. Fortunately, there is a solution to this challenge - implementing a CX platform that leverages chatbots and other AI-powered tools to provide effective and personalized customer interactions. Here are the key steps to implementing a CX platform that can take your customer engagement to the next level:

Step 1: Integration

The first step in implementing a CX platform is to integrate it with the messaging apps your brand uses. This involves creating a connection between the platform and the messaging app's API, enabling the platform to send and receive messages on the brand's behalf. This integration ensures that the chatbots can access customer messages in real-time and respond with personalized and timely messages.

Step 2: Chatbot creation

After integrating the CX platform with messaging apps, brands can create chatbots to handle customer interactions. Chatbots are AI-powered tools that engage in natural language conversations with customers, providing quick answers to common questions and routing more complex inquiries to human agents as needed. Creating chatbots is easy with CX platforms that offer intuitive and user-friendly interfaces. Brands can create chatbots that reflect their brand identity and provide a seamless experience to customers.

Step 3: Personalization

CX platforms use Natural Language Processing (NLP) to understand the context and intent of customer messages, allowing them to provide personalized responses that are tailored to the customer's needs. For instance, if a customer asks about the status of their order, the chatbot can provide a real-time update based on the customer's specific order details. This level of personalization not only satisfies customers but also builds trust and loyalty.

Step 4: Automation

CX platforms can automate various tasks to streamline customer interactions and internal workflows. For example, the platform can automate appointment scheduling, order tracking, and payment processing, freeing up human agents to focus on more complex issues. Automation ensures that customers receive quick and accurate responses to their inquiries, enhancing their overall experience.

Step 5: Analytics

Finally, CX platforms provide detailed analytics and reporting on customer interactions, enabling brands to track key metrics like response times, customer satisfaction, and issue resolution rates. This data can be used to continually improve the customer experience and optimize internal processes. With detailed analytics, brands can identify areas for improvement and make data-driven decisions to enhance their customer experience.
